EVOLUTION AND SELF-ASSEMBLY

Organizers: Kristian Lindgren and Martin Jacobi (Chalmers Technical University – Sweden), Norman Packard (ProtoLife, Venice – Italy)





PURPOSE
This is primarily an internal PACE workshop to connect the evolutionary approaches from different groups. The themes include the objectives of WP2 “Evolution and self-asssembly”:
O-2.1 Exploration of evolutionary paths to forming artificial cells and evolving desired functionality.
O-2.2 Exploration of possibilities to avoid exploitation including various forms of spatial separation.
O-2.3 Exploration of evolvability of higher level cell functionality, including interactions between artificial cells.
O-2.4 Simulation of self-assembly of complex functional ensembles of artificial cells and their potential as distributed robotic system.
